So look around at your local credit union or bank and get a rate. on e you have the lowest rate, shave off a half percent and bring it to the dealer with your credit score and say my credit score is X and I can get a percentage rate of Y (Saving off half a point). If you mr dealer can beat it, I’ll go through you. Worked for me 3x now.

Good income and great credit here. I had a good pre-qual from capital one (2.5%) who I used on my last vehicle, and dealer told me Ford wouldn’t beat that but a credit union might. I ended up with a 1.99% for 60 months from the credit union with no early payoff fees. This was back at the end of January though and I know rates have increased. Some perspective on rates. First car loan I had was in 1983 on a Subaru. 17%! Re did the loan a year later as rates were comming down. Of course you could get a 12 month CD with 12%+ returns. First home loan in '90 was 10% and that was with 20% down and excellent credit. I have enjoyed the recent sub 3% loans but think those days are done.
